Why is Website Tracking Compliance Important?

Website tracking compliance helps organizations ensure that their tracking technologies operate consistently with privacy laws, user consent preferences, and public disclosures.
Misconfigured tracking technologies or inaccurate privacy disclosures can lead to regulatory scrutiny, consumer complaints, or litigation alleging deceptive practices or failure to honor user choices.
